It's not a black and white issue with meds.  Meds first is right for some people, therapy first is right for others.  If you have a chemical imbalance in your brain, all the talk therapy in the world isn't going to cure it.  If life has reached up and smacked you in the head (like losing a family member) then you can bet talk therapy would probably be your first line of treatment.  After therapy, your brain made need a little push to get the serotonin where it belongs, and a course of meds might be right for you.
